From Fresh Blooms to Everlasting Beauty
The process of transforming fresh flowers into dried arrangements begins with careful selection. Flowers that naturally hold their structure and color—such as roses, hydrangeas, lavender, and baby’s breath—are the best choices for preservation. These flowers are harvested at their peak to ensure they maintain their beauty even after drying.
Popular Drying Methods
Florists use various techniques to preserve flowers, ensuring they remain vibrant and elegant:
- Air Drying: Flowers are hung upside down in a dark, dry place for several weeks to allow moisture to evaporate naturally.
- Silica Gel Drying: Flowers are buried in silica gel crystals to retain their shape and color.
- Pressing: Ideal for smaller flowers, pressing removes moisture and flattens blooms for use in artwork and keepsakes.
- Freeze Drying: A high-end technique that locks in color and shape by removing moisture in a vacuum chamber.
Each method results in a unique aesthetic, allowing florists to create a wide range of dried floral arrangements for various occasions.
Why Choose Dried Flowers?
Dried flowers offer numerous benefits, making them a popular choice among customers:
1. Long-Lasting Elegance
Unlike fresh flowers that wilt within days, dried flowers can last months or even years with proper care.
2. Low Maintenance
No need for water or sunlight—dried flowers stay beautiful with minimal effort.
3. Sustainable and Eco-Friendly
Since they require no refrigeration or frequent replacements, dried flowers are a more environmentally friendly choice than fresh-cut blooms.
4. Versatile in Styling
From rustic bouquets to modern minimalist arrangements, dried flowers complement any decor style.

Creative Ways to Use Dried Flowers
Dried flowers are more than just decorative pieces—they offer a wide range of uses:
- Home Decor: Display them in vases, create wreaths, or hang them on walls for a bohemian touch.
- Weddings & Events: Dried floral bouquets and table centerpieces add an elegant, rustic vibe to celebrations.
- Handmade Gifts: Pressed flowers can be used in resin jewelry, bookmarks, and greeting cards.
- Aromatherapy: Lavender, rose petals, and other scented flowers make excellent potpourri and sachets.

Caring for Dried Flowers
To keep dried flowers looking their best, follow these simple care tips:
- Keep them away from direct sunlight to prevent fading.
- Store them in a dry environment to avoid moisture damage.
- Gently dust them using a soft brush or a hairdryer on a cool setting.
With the right care, dried flowers can maintain their charm and elegance for years.
